LEGO al CES: in arrivo un mattoncino smart che rivoluzionerà il gioco?
LEGO fa il suo ingresso al CES 2026 con un intrigante teaser su un possibile mattoncino smart. Cosa bolle in pentola? Scopri tutti i dettagli il 5 gennaio alle 19:00!
Come costruire un mattoncino smart LEGO: Guida passo-passo
Introduzione
Negli ultimi anni, la tecnologia ha iniziato a permeare anche il mondo dei giochi e dei mattoncini, dando vita a progetti innovativi e coinvolgenti. LEGO ha sempre avuto un occhio di riguardo verso l'innovazione, e con i recenti rumor su un possibile mattoncino smart, l'interesse si fa sempre più intenso. In questa guida pratica, esploreremo come costruire un mattoncino smart utilizzando la tecnologia LEGO e componenti elettronici, permettendoti di dare vita a progetti interattivi e personalizzati. Questa guida non solo ti fornirà tutte le istruzioni necessarie, ma ti darà anche suggerimenti utili per risolvere eventuali problemi e ottimizzare le tue creazioni.
Requisiti/Materiali necessari
Prima di iniziare, assicurati di avere a disposizione i seguenti materiali:
1. Set LEGO compatibile: un set base di LEGO, preferibilmente con mattoncini di diverse forme e dimensioni.
2. Microcontrollore: un dispositivo come Arduino o un Raspberry Pi, ideale per la programmazione.
3. Sensori: puoi utilizzare sensori di movimento, sensori di luce o pulsanti per rendere il tuo mattoncino smart interattivo.
4. Moduli di comunicazione: moduli Bluetooth o Wi-Fi per la connettività.
5. Cavi e connettori: per collegare i vari componenti elettronici.
6. Software di programmazione: utilizza l'IDE di Arduino o qualsiasi software adatto per programmare il tuo microcontrollore.
Istruzioni passo-passo
1. Progetta il tuo mattoncino smart
Inizia disegnando un progetto dello smart brick. Puoi ispirarti a modelli già esistenti o creare un design completamente originale. Pensa a quali funzionalità vuoi implementare (es. accensione di luci, suoni o interazione tramite app).
2. Assemblea il microcontrollore
Collega il microcontrollore secondo le istruzioni del produttore. Questo sarà il cervello del tuo mattoncino smart e gestirà tutti i componenti elettronici.
- Collegamenti: Assicurati di seguire il diagramma di collegamento del microcontrollore per evitare cortocircuiti.
3. Integra i sensori
Collega i sensori al tuo microcontrollore. Ogni sensore avrà un certo numero di pin da collegare.
- Esempio di collegamento: Se stai usando un sensore di movimento, collega il pin di uscita del sensore a uno dei pin digitali del microcontrollore.
4. Programma il microcontrollore
Utilizza l'IDE di Arduino per scrivere il codice necessario per il funzionamento del tuo mattoncino smart. Ti consiglio di iniziare con un codice semplice per testare ogni componente singolarmente.
- Codice di esempio: Inizia con un codice che accende un LED quando il sensore di movimento rileva un movimento.
```cpp
#include <Arduino.h>
const int sensorPin = 2; // Pin del sensore di movimento
const int ledPin = 13; // Pin del LED
void setup() {
pinMode(sensorPin, INPUT);
pinMode(ledPin, OUTPUT);
}
void loop() {
int sensorValue = digitalRead(sensorPin);
if (sensorValue == HIGH) {
digitalWrite(ledPin, HIGH); // Accendi il LED
} else {
digitalWrite(ledPin, LOW); // Spegni il LED
}
}
```
5. Testa il progetto
Dopo aver caricato il codice sul microcontrollore, testalo. Muovi il sensore e verifica che il LED si accenda o spenga correttamente. Se qualcosa non funziona, controlla i collegamenti e il codice.
6. Costruisci l'involucro in LEGO
Usa i mattoncini LEGO per costruire una custodia attorno al tuo microcontrollore e ai sensori. Assicurati che siano accessibili e visibili.
- Suggerimento: Lascia delle aperture per la ventilazione, soprattutto se il tuo progetto prevede componenti che generano calore.
7. Aggiungi funzioni extra
Una volta che il tuo mattoncino smart funziona correttamente, aggiungi altre funzionalità. Puoi integrare moduli Bluetooth per il controllo tramite smartphone, o sensori di temperatura per un progetto più avanzato.
8. Programma l'app di controllo (facoltativo)
Se decidi di utilizzare la connettività, puoi sviluppare un'app semplice per controllare il tuo mattoncino smart. Puoi utilizzare strumenti come MIT App Inventor per facilitare la creazione di app.
Suggerimenti e consigli utili
- Documenta il processo: Tieni traccia di ogni modifica che fai al codice e ai collegamenti. Questo ti aiuterà a risolvere eventuali problemi futuri.
- Collegamenti solidi: Usa saldature o morsetti per garantire collegamenti affidabili e duraturi.
- Sperimenta: Non aver paura di provare idee stravaganti o nuove. La progettazione è un processo creativo!
Risoluzione problemi comuni
- Il LED non si accende: Controlla se il microcontrollore è alimentato e se i collegamenti del LED sono corretti.
- Il sensore non rileva movimento: Verifica che il sensore sia collegato correttamente e che sia nella giusta posizione.
- Programma non si carica: Assicurati di selezionare la corretta porta COM nell'IDE e che il driver del microcontrollore sia installato.
Conclusioni e riepilogo
Costruire un mattoncino smart LEGO è un progetto entusiasmante che combina creatività e tecnologia. Seguendo questa guida passo-passo, avrai le conoscenze necessarie per iniziare il tuo viaggio nel fantastico mondo della programmazione e della robotica LEGO. Sperimenta, costruisci e divertiti a dare vita ai tuoi sogni con i mattoncini smart!
Ricorda che il mondo della tecnologia è in costante evoluzione, quindi continua a esplorare e innovare!
Commenti (0)
Nessun commento ancora. Sii il primo a commentare!